The
annual award, which has been instituted by AfricaRice in honor of the late Dr
Robert Carsky, is conferred on the most outstanding Internationally Recruited
Staff (IRS) and the most outstanding General Support Staff (GSS), who have
demonstrated high standards of excellence and made extraordinary contributions
to rice research, training and research support.
Dr
Khady Nani Dramé, Head of the AfricaRice Capacity Development Unit, received
the 2018 AfricaRice Dr Robert Carsky Award for IRS on 11 April at the 43rd
Meeting of the AfricaRice Board of Trustees, Abidjan, Côte d’Ivoire. She
received the prestigious award in recognition of her outstanding contributions
to rice research in Africa and her commitment to AfricaRice in its efforts to
boost rice self-sufficiency in the continent.
The
AfricaRice Guesthouse support team in Bouaké – Mr Joanny Zigani, Mr Pierre
Batiebé and Mr Moussa Koné – received the 2018 AfricaRice Dr Robert Carsky
Award for GSS not only for their efficiency, quality of service warmth and
hospitality, but also for their exceptional dedication and the sacrifices they
made to serve the guests, particularly during the Ivorian crisis period.
Mrs
Rebecca Khelseau-Carsky was invited to hand over the 2018 AfricaRice Dr Robert
Carsky Award to the winners.
